Part 1: Top LEGAL IPTV Providers in France & Morocco

These are the safest, most reliable, and recommended options.

In France:

1. Freebox TV (Free)

   · The Benchmark. Included with Freebox internet plans, offering hundreds of channels. Add-ons for Canal+, beIN SPORTS, and more are available.

   · Why it's top: Ultra-reliable, integrated with the Freebox ecosystem, and offers a complete legal service.

2. Orange TV (Orange)

   · A major competitor to Free, offering robust IPTV service bundled with Orange Livebox internet plans.

   · Why it's top: Strong performance, good channel selection, and reliable customer support.

3. Molotov.tv

   · A revolutionary legal streaming app that aggregates free-to-air channels (TF1, France 2, M6, etc.) and offers premium subscriptions.

   · Why it's top: Works on almost any device (Smart TV, phone, console), has a beautiful interface, and is a fantastic legal alternative.

4. Canal+

   · The historic giant of French pay-TV. Their subscription gives access to premium channels, exclusive content, football leagues, and cinema.

   · Why it's top: Unrivaled for premium French and international content, especially sports and original series.

5. beIN SPORTS Connect

   · The official streaming platform for the beIN SPORTS channels.

   · Why it's top: The essential legal service for sports fans in France, offering Ligue 1, UEFA Champions League, and more.

In Morocco:

1. Istyplay (Maroc Telecom)

   · The leading official IPTV service in Morocco. It's bundled with various Maroc Telecom internet plans.

   · Why it's top: Offers all key Moroccan channels (2M, Al Aoula, Medi1 TV, Arryadia), Arab channels, and optional premium packages. It is 100% legal and provides a buffer-free experience.

2. beIN SPORTS Connect

   · Just as in France, this is the official and legal way to stream beIN SPORTS content in Morocco.

   · Why it's top: Essential for watching Botola, Ligue 1, La Liga, and other major sports events legally.

3. OSN+

   · A popular streaming platform in the MENA region offering a wide variety of Western movies, series, and kids' content.

   · Why it's top: A great legal supplement for on-demand Hollywood and international content.

Part 2: Understanding "Unofficial" IPTV Services

This is what many people search for, but it comes with significant risks.

What They Promises:

· Thousands of channels from every country (France, Morocco, USA, UK, Arab world, etc.).

· All premium channels (Canal+, beIN, Sky Sports, ESPN) for a single low fee ($10-$15/month).

· Huge Video on Demand (VOD) libraries with the latest movies and series.

· This is their primary appeal: vast content at a low price.

The Significant Risks:

· Illegality: Distributing and accessing copyrighted content without a license is illegal.

· Scams: Many services take your money and disappear.

· Instability: Services can buffer, freeze, or be shut down permanently, especially during major sports events.

· Security: Potential for malware or data privacy issues.
